在数字化飞速发展的今天,虚拟服务器的使用变得越来越普遍。无论是个人开发者、初创企业,还是大型企业,虚拟服务器都为他们提供了灵活、高效且经济的解决方案。对于初学者而言,虚拟服务器的操作可能显得复杂,尤其是在访问方式与安全策略方面。本文将针对虚拟服务器的操作入门知识进行详细分析,帮助读者全面了解这一领域。
什么是虚拟服务器?虚拟服务器指的是在物理服务器上通过虚拟化技术创建的多个独立环境。每个虚拟服务器都可以运行自己的操作系统和应用,彼此之间完全隔离。这种方式不仅能够充分利用物理服务器的资源,还可以根据实际需求进行灵活调整。
接下来,我们将从访问方式开始讨论虚拟服务器的操作。虚拟服务器的访问方式主要有以下几种:
1. **SSH访问**:SSH(Secure Shell)是一种网络协议,主要用于在不安全的网络中安全地访问远程服务器。对于Linux系统的虚拟服务器,SSH是最常用的访问方式。用户需要在本地计算机上使用SSH客户端(如Putty、OpenSSH等),输入虚拟服务器的IP地址,以及用户名和密码进行连接。SSH访问不仅安全,而且可以通过命令行远程管理服务器,使得操作灵活便捷。
2. **远程桌面协议(RDP)**:对于Windows系统的虚拟服务器,RDP是最常用的访问方式。用户可以通过Windows自带的远程桌面连接工具,通过输入IP地址和凭证直接访问图形界面。这种方式适合需要在图形界面中进行操作的用户,例如使用某些图形设计软件或进行应用程序测试。
3. **Web管理界面**:一些云服务提供商(如AWS、Azure、Aliyun等)提供网页式控制台,用户可以通过浏览器访问该控制台,进行对虚拟服务器的管理。通过Web界面,用户可以直观地查看服务器的状态、配置参数,并进行启动、关闭、重启等操作。这种方式对于不熟悉命令行的用户来说,是一种友好的选择。
4. **API访问**:对于一些需要程序自动化管理虚拟服务器的场景,API访问是一个重要的手段。许多云服务商提供RESTful API,用户可以通过编写脚本或程序来批量管理虚拟服务器。这种方式不仅可以减少人为操作的错误,还能够快速部署和管理大量的资源。
了解了虚拟服务器的访问方式后,我们再来讨论相关的安全策略。安全是操作虚拟服务器时必须重视的问题,以下是一些常见的安全策略:
1. **强密码管理**:无论是SSH还是RDP,强密码都是确保账户安全的第一道防线。建议使用长度超过12位,并包含大写、小写、数字及特殊字符的复杂密码。定期更换密码也是一种良好的安全管理习惯。
2. **使用SSH密钥认证**:对于SSH访问,使用密钥认证比密码更安全。用户可以生成一对公钥和私钥,将公钥上传到虚拟服务器,并在本地计算机中保存私钥。通过密钥认证方式登录,能够有效避免暴力破解攻击。
3. **防火墙配置**:合理配置防火墙是保护虚拟服务器不被非法访问的重要措施。用户应根据需要开放必要的端口,同时关闭不必要的端口,并定期审核防火墙规则,确保配置的安全性。
4. **定期更新和打补丁**:虚拟服务器的操作系统和应用程序都需要定期更新,以防止安全漏洞被利用。及时修补已知漏洞,能够有效提升服务器的安全等级。
5. **入侵检测系统(IDS)**:对于一些对安全要求较高的业务,部署入侵检测系统可以监控服务器的运行状态,及时发现并应对潜在的安全威胁。通过实时分析流量和行为,可以大幅度降低被攻击的风险。
6. **备份与恢复策略**:定期备份虚拟服务器的数据和配置文件是确保数据安全的重要措施。无论是由于人为错误还是系统故障,拥有最近的备份可以帮助用户迅速恢复服务,降低损失。
虚拟服务器是现代IT基础设施中不可或缺的一部分。了解虚拟服务器的访问方式及其安全策略,不仅帮助用户高效地进行管理和操作,也为数据和服务提供了一层重要的保障。希望本文所述的内容能够帮助初学者们更好地入门虚拟服务器的世界。